Step 1: Create Your Sanctuary

Before you begin, environment matters more than you might think. Find a quiet corner in your home where you will not be disturbed for the next ten minutes. Dim the lights slightly or open a window to let in natural light. Ensure your posture is upright yet relaxed; you can sit on a cushion on the floor or in a chair with your feet flat on the ground. The key is to feel supported but alert. Take a deep breath in through your nose, holding it for a count of four, and exhale slowly through your mouth. Repeat this three times to signal to your body that it is time to shift into a state of rest and awareness.

Step 2: Focus on the Breath

Close your eyes gently and bring your full attention to your natural breathing pattern. Do not try to control the breath; simply observe it. Notice the cool air entering your nostrils and the warm air leaving your body. Feel the gentle rise and fall of your chest or abdomen. When your mind inevitably wanders to your to-do list or past conversations, do not judge yourself. Acknowledge the thought, label it simply as “thinking,” and gently guide your attention back to the sensation of breathing. This act of returning your focus is the core exercise of meditation.
